The document discusses how event-driven architectures are becoming more common for modern enterprises. It notes that by 2022, 70% of new digital business solutions will require real-time event processing capabilities. The document promotes the use of event mesh, which is an architectural layer of distributed event brokers that can reliably route events across environments. Event mesh provides uniform connectivity, scalability, security, and governance for event-driven systems. The document provides several case studies of large companies like American Express, SAP, and Singapore's LTA that rely on Solace event brokers for their event-driven architectures and Internet of Things solutions.
